SCOTUS Stay on USAID Cuts
- The Supreme Court temporarily halted the Trump administration's USAID fund freeze.
- This is a temporary stay, not a final ruling, and requires new filings by Friday.
Supreme Court Dynamics
- The Supreme Court's decision on the USAID fund freeze isn't a slam dunk for Trump.
- Justices Kavanaugh and Alito likely favor expansive presidential power, but others like Gorsuch and Barrett may side with the liberals.
Trump Settles Elon Question
- Trump fully endorsed Elon Musk's authority in a cabinet meeting.
- Trump told cabinet members unhappy with Elon to leave, solidifying Elon's control over federal agency guidance and cuts.
